    Curry Leaves ButterMilk

    March 16, 2022 By Anlet Prince Leave a Comment

    Curry Leaves ButterMilk is a refreshing drink for summer. Buttermilk is made after diluting Curd with water. Buttermilk helps prevent dehydration and gives nice cooling effect in summer. Curry Leaves ButterMilk has the goodness of Curry Leaves and buttermilk. This drink helps in weightloss. It helps in managing Diabetes too.     Step by step Photos

    1. Add in Curd and Curry Leaves into a blender.
    Curry LEaves ButterMilk step

    2. Add Black Pepper and Cumin Seeds.

    Curry LEaves ButterMilk step

    3. Add in Ginger and salt to taste.

    Curry LEaves ButterMilk step

    4. Add Water and blend them.

    Curry LEaves ButterMilk step

    Cooling and hydrating buttermilk is now ready to serve.

    Curry Leaves ButterMilk

    Course: Drinks
    Cuisine: Indian
    Keyword: buttermilk, curry Leaves

    Ingredients

    • ¼ Cup Curd
    • 1 Cup Water
    • Salt to taste
    • 3 Black Pepper
    • ¼ tsp Cumin Seeds
    • ¼ tsp ginger

    Instructions

    • Add all the ingredients into a blender and blend smooth
    • The cooling and soothing Curry Leaves is now ready to serve.

    Tips

    • Curry Leaves in this recipe can be replaced with Mint leaves or Coriander Leaves.
